I am selling my 1968 Camaro RS Running and Driving Car Documented 82,286 Miles All Numbers Matching This 1968 Camaro was purchased brand new in Pittsburgh, PA by a local guy. The Camaro was later acquired by a dealership in 1995. On 5/31/95 the next owner traded in his 1992 Harley to the dealership so he could purchase the Camaro. Not too long after owning the Camaro the tranny started to slip. He then parked the Camaro in his garage in 1996 and it sat since. His close friend ended up buying the Camaro from him and sent the transmission out to be completely rebuilt. He then re installed it and ran all new lines. He then undercoated the bottom of the car if you were wondering why it looked weird in the picture. He then took the stock 2 Barrel intake off and installed an Edelbrock intake, HEI distributor and a new water pump. The guy lost interest in finishing it and thats where I came in to buy it. Since then I put the Carb on, new alternator, new starter, removed old rusted fuel lines and replaced it with a new rubber line, installed new wires, new plugs, and a few other odds and ends. All that needs to be done is to adjust the timing and I think adjust carb air fuel mixture (I would have done it but I don't have a timing light and never adjusted a carb in my life). The car does Run, Drive, and Stop well just little things need tweaking. The Paint is driver quality (some chips, scratches, bubbles), the vinyl top is in amazing condition and has no rust bubbles whatsoever underneath, and lastly the interior is in original immaculate condition (radio also works). This 1968 Camaro Rally Sport is a great cruiser for the summer. Included is the original Protection Plate, Owners Manual, Purchasing letter, and a few other papers from when the first and second owner purchased it. The Original Color of the Camaro was Ash Gold. The Camaro had one repaint. Details: -Numbers Matching 327 -Powerglide Automatic Transmission *Completely Rebuilt* (also has new fly wheel and torque converter).-Undercoating is flaking off of underneath so I pulled some off of the floor pans and they are solid-Rear frame rails are solid-Driver side rear passenger window is off track and won't roll up (besides that one little window all the others go up and down very nice). -Doors, hood, and trunk lid open and shut great-Steers and brakes nicely-Interior is all Original and in Immaculate Condition -Headliner is very nice and intact-Rear brake lines are new-New rear shocks-New Alternator-New starter -New plugs + wires-New water pump-New Intake-New Hoses upper + lower-New Fuel line ETC.....
